Energy efficiency

If you want to make your home more energy efficient, double-glazed windows are a great option. They will keep your house warmer in the winter months and cool in the summer. They will also help lower your energy bills. In fact, you could save up to 12 percent of your annual energy costs with these windows.

A double-glazed window is one that has two panes of glass that are sealed hermetically. Each pane is separated by a spacer and the space is then filled with an inert gas (usually argon or krypton). These gases serve as insulation, allowing heat in your home. Double glazed windows are more energy efficient than single-pane windows.

The frame material, dimensions and the type of glazing are all elements that influence energy efficiency. uPVC frames, for example are more energy efficient than timber and aluminium. The argon gas, or krypton that fills the gap between the glass panes can also lower your energy bill.

Security

Double glazing can increase your home security by making it harder for burglars to break into your property. This is due to the fact that single glass panes and timber or aluminium windows can be broken relatively easily by opportunistic or professional thieves. Double glazing is comprised of two glass panes and locking mechanisms that are much more resistant to breakage. This makes it much more difficult for burglars to enter your home or double glazing installers near me property. They can also be prevented from damaging valuable objects and taking them.

Double-glazed windows are constructed from two glass panes with a gap between them, which is sealed together inside a unit called an IGU (insulated glazing unit). The glass is laminated, or tempered, to increase its strength, and the space between them is filled with air or more commonly, argon gas. This gas is non-toxic, odourless and has insulation properties.

There are many options for glass, including tints, UV blockers and low-e films, which are energy efficient. You can upgrade to toughened safety glass that is five times more durable than standard glass and reduces chance of injury in case of a break, especially for young children.
